Blacklisted 3 was a Project M national tournament, and the third installment of the Blacklisted tournament series. It was the 6th event in the 2017 Project M Championship Circuit. With 192 singles entrants, it is currently the largest Project M tournament in the history of New England, beating the record of 154 set by GUTS 3. The tournament also hosted numerous side events, including YOLO, 3.02, All Star, Nolimar only (Olimar without Pikmin), Random All Star, Poke Balls on, Random Partner Doubles, and Blindfolded Doubles brackets.

Trivia
- Kalne, Japan's top player, as well as another Japanese player, bnd, were flown out as part of the compendium to compete in the United States for the first time, marking the first time that Japanese players have traveled to a US Project M event after the release of version 3.6.
